Special Stitches

Fan (fan): In same chain space, [dc, ch 1] 7 times, dc. When at the beginning of a round, in same chain space, ch 4 (counts as dc plus ch 1), [dc, ch 1] 6 times, dc.

Shell (sh): In same chain space, [dc, ch 1] 3 times, dc. (This shell is the one worked only in the border of the poncho.)

V-Stitch (v-st): [Dc, ch 2, dc] in same chain space.

Cluster (cl): Yo, insert hook in st or sp indicated, yo, pull lp through, yo, pull through 2 lps on hook, [yo, insert hook in same st or sp, yo, pull lp through, yo, pull through 2 lps on hook] twice, yo, pull through 4 lps on hook.

Notes

This border can be used for any square or rectangle. It requires a multiple of 10, plus 7, on the sides, with ch-2 spaces at the corners.

Instructions

Round 1: Join yarn with sl st to any corner, ch 1, *[sc, ch 6, sc] in ch-2 sp, sc in next 2 sc, [ch 6, sk 3 sc, sc in next 2 sc] to corner ch-2 sp, rep from * 3 times more, sl st to first sc and into ch-6 sp.

Round 2: *Fan (see Special Stitches above) in ch-6 sp of corner, sh (see Special Stitches above) in each ch-6 sp to next corner, rep from * 3 times more, sl st to third ch of beg ch-4 and into ch-1 sp.

Round 3: Ch 2, *[cl (see Special Stitches above), ch 2] in each ch-1 sp of fan, cl in center ch-1 sp of sh, ch 2, [cl, ch 2] in each ch-1 sp of next sh, repeating to next corner, ending side with cl in center ch-1 sp of last sh before corner, ch 2, rep from * 3 times more, sl st to first cl and into ch-2 sp.

Round 4: Ch 1, *[sc, ch 3] in each ch-2 sp of corner, [cl in next ch-2 sp] twice, ch 3, [sc in next ch-2 sp, ch 3] twice, repeating to next corner, ending side with [cl in next ch-2 sp] twice, ch 3, rep from * 3 times more, sl st to first sc and into ch-3 sp.

Round 5: Ch 2, *[cl, ch 3] in each ch-3 sp at corner, [sc in next ch-3 sp, ch 3] twice, [cl, ch 3, cl] in next ch-3 sp, ch 3, repeating to next corner, ending side at last two clusters with [sc in next ch-3 sp, ch 3] twice, rep from * 3 times more, sl st to first cl and into ch-3 sp.

Round 6: Ch 1, *[sc, ch 5] in each ch-3 sp at corner, [sc in next ch-3 sp, v-st (see Special Stitches above) in next ch-3 sp, sc in next ch-3 sp, ch 5, sc in ch-3 sp between 2 cl, ch 5] to corner, repeating to next corner, ending side with sc in next ch-3 sp, v-st in next ch-3 sp, sc in next ch-3 sp, ch-5, sl st to first sc, fasten off.

Finishing

Weave in ends securely.
